On
February 18, 2001, Sandra Katanick celebrated her ten
year anniversary as Executive Director of the ICAVL. This date
is also the ten year anniversary of the opening of the ICAVL
office. Prior to her appointment as Executive Director in 1991,
Ms. Katanick served as a founding Board member to the ICAVL,
the first of the Intersocietal organizations, representing the
Society of Diagnostic Medical Sonographers. During the ten years
that she has held the position of Executive Director, Ms. Katanick
has been responsible for the formation of the three additional
accrediting bodies that now join the ICAVL under the Intersocietal
Accreditation Commission (IAC). The Intersocietal Commission
for the Accreditation of Echocardiography Laboratories, incorporated
in December of 1996; the Intersocietal Commission for the Accreditation
of Nuclear Medicine Laboratories, incorporated in December of
1997, and the Intersocietal Commission for the Accreditation
of Magnetic Resonance Laboratories, incorporated in February
of 2000.
In
celebration of this distinctive accomplishment, the IAC staff
honored Ms. Katanick (top row, center, in the photograph above)
with a luncheon and the presentation of a plaque recognizing
her distinguished accomplishments and contributions.
